Description
During excavation of the quarry face it became apparent that the south-east face of the borrow-pit was in danger of being undermined and collapsing, which would lead to the loss of one of the nearby clearance cairns. An area 5m wide was topsoil stripped immediately back from the quarry face and the clearance cairn was fully excavated. <1>
